Wire gauze comes in several square sizes including 4 inches by 4 inches 5 inches by 5 inches and 6 inches by 6 inches to fit different bunsen burners and other equipment.
What is a gauze mat used for in science. It is most likely to be made of thick metal threads threaded into a mat or square. A piece of laboratory apparatus consisting of a flat piece of wire gauze placed on a tripod to give a beaker or flask additional support or to distribute heat more evenly. A gauze mat is used below bunsen burners as it protects the tripod or surface which the bunsen burner might be on.
